The first mixed doubles semi-final of the Danish Open of the BWF Tour ended, and Wang Yilu and Huang Dongping were reversed and missed the final. Facing the Japanese duo of Yudai Watanabe/Yusa Higashino, Wang Yilu/Huang Dongping won one set and then were won two consecutive sets by their opponents, and they lost 1-2.

Wang Yilu / Huang Dongping is the favorite to win the tournament, the Japanese combination of Watanabe Isa and Higashino Yusa also has strong strength, and the previous head-to-head record of the two pairs is that Wang Yilu / Huang Dongping is absolutely dominant with 10 wins and 1 loss.

The Japanese team quickly led the way after the start of the first set, but the Yellow Ducks group responded with a counter-attack. The Japanese duo returned the lead by 3 points, and the Yellow Ducks set off a new offensive, scoring consecutive points after 11 draws, and then they countered the opponent's counterattack to take a 21-16 lead. The Japanese duo quickly led the way in the second set, with they withstood multiple shocks from the Yellow Ducks duo to pull back a city 21-17.

In the decider, Wang Yilu/Huang Dongping started behind again, with the Japanese duo leading the exchange 11-9. The Yellow Ducks duo chased after Yibian, they chased to 15 draws, 16 draws, and at the key moment, Watanabe Yudai / Higashino Yusa scored 4 points to get match points. The Yellow Ducks team saved 1 match point, and the Japanese team won the decider 21-17 with 1 point, and they narrowly won 2-1.

In the women's singles semifinals, He Bingjiao unfortunately lost the final. In the confrontation with Japan's famous Akane Yamaguchi, He Bingjiao lost both sets with extra points, and she lost 0-2 to stop in the semifinals.

He Bingjiao and Akane Yamaguchi are both favorites for this Open Championship, and they will reach the final four all the way. In the previous confrontation records between the two, Akane Yamaguchi had an absolute advantage, she had an advantage of 11 wins and 1 loss, and He Bingjiao had lost to Akane Yamaguchi 6 times in a row.

Akane Yamaguchi quickly pulled away to lead the way in the first set, and as the game progressed, He Bingjiao's form got better and better, and she scored consecutive points to tie 14. Akane Yamaguchi quickly set off another wave of attack, and she took the lead 20-17 to get the set point. He Bingjiao saved 3 consecutive innings to tie, but unfortunately she was unable to seize the opportunity of the set point afterwards, and Akane Yamaguchi scored two consecutive points after 21 draws to win the first set 23-21.

In the second set, Akane Yamaguchi quickly led the way, and He Bingjiao, who was behind by the score, chased after her, and when she was 7-14 behind, she set off a counterattack, chasing 7 points in a row to draw 14. Akane Yamaguchi scored 2 more points to lead the way again, and He Bingjiao responded with 2 points to tie again. After that, He Bingjiao led the way twice and took the lead in the set, but Yamaguchi Akane defused the crisis and leveled it. After 20 draws, Akane Yamaguchi seized the opportunity to score two consecutive points, 22-20, she won the second set to eliminate He Bingjiao 2-0 to enter the final.
